Interpreting in the Church Workshop

Connie Miller and Kathy Baynes will be presenting a workshop for church
interpreters who want to improve their skills while interpreting in a
religious situations.

The date is Saturday, March 6, 2010 at Family Cathedral of Praise in
Mesquite, Texas from 9 am to 2 pm.

We will be discussing how to
use classifiers in church interpreting
church phases
how to sign slow and fast songs
How to go to the next level … from an interpreting service to a deaf
ministry.

If you are a church interpreter or a student of as and would like to improve
your skills …. please email me at conniecaymiller@aol.com to register

The cost of the workshop is $20.00 for pre-registration, and $25.00 at the
door.
(this is a fund raiser that will enable us to take our deaf choir to
minister in at a deaf camp) .

As of now , there will not be any CEU’s for this workshop but expect another
workshop on the second Saturday in April.
